Learning to play the piano offers a multitude of benefits that extend beyond the realm of music. It stimulates cognitive development, improves memory and concentration, and enhances problem-solving skills. Playing the piano requires coordination between both hands, which helps improve f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ination. Moreover, it serves as a wonderful outlet for self-expression, allowing students to communicate and connect with others through music.
